I wouldn't really recommend putting a water cooling solution on a locked CPU... kahit 100% CPU usage, hindi mag-ooverheat yan eh :noidea: tapos meron pang water maintenance yan after around a year or so... meron kasing mga bacteria build-up at metal corrosion eh ang mga liquid cooling solutions (yes, even if treated with anti-freeze, anti-bacterial and anti-corrosive chemicals)
also, sa water cooling, hindi rin recommended ang mga single fan/radiator kasi kelangan ng mga liquid cooling ang mataas na volume ng tubig at malapad na surface area to dissipate heat.
lagyan mo lang ng decent cpu cooler bababa na yan at around 60°C at 100% cpu load... idle temps would actually go down to around +20°C. e.g. CoolerMaster Hyper 212X & Cryorig H7, both for less than 2k

about i7 8700k vs i7 9700k... in my opinion, mas superior ang 8700k kesa sa mas bagong 9700k... though the newer has 8 physical cores, the older generation has 12 threads which is better for multiple processes. sobra namang overpriced ang i9 9900k :rofl:
gaming... meh... pareho lang yan... barely a couple of fps apart depende kung paano mo i-overclock.

yung ROG branded usually binned ang pinaka-gpu nyan. which means it was pre-selected with higher expected boost/overclocking potential than the average 1080ti (or similar gpu). the ROG brand of asus carries it's flagship line, while yung strix ay pang-"mid tier" branding nila which usually includes RGB lightning
